The scalp showed raised, flaccid blisters and exfoliative skin with erythema, associated with a positive … WitrynaSome cancer treatments can damage the cells that line your mouth or throat. Soreness and ulceration of the lining of the mouth or throat is called mucositis. It can be very painful. Mucositis can be caused by: chemotherapy. targeted therapy. immunotherapy. radiotherapy to the head and neck. Some skin problems resolve themselves after you finish treatment. ... Blisters … Witryna14 paź 2024 · Treatment can help heal your skin so that bullous pemphigoid goes into remission. Treatment can also help relieve the itch and pain. Medication: Your dermatologist may prescribe creams and ointments called corticosteroids.
